1. Definition of a circle: a curve graph on a plane.

2. Fold a circular piece of paper twice, and the point where the crease intersects the center of the circle is called the center of the circle. The center of the circle is generally represented by the letter O, and its distance to any point on the circle is equal.

3. Radius: The line segment connecting the center of the circle and any point on the circle is called radius. The radius is generally represented by the letter R. If the two feet of a compass are separated, the distance between the two feet is the radius of the circle.

4. The center of the circle determines the position of the circle and the radius determines the size of the circle.

5. Diameter: The line segment whose two ends pass through the center of the circle is called diameter. The diameter is usually indicated by the letter d.

6. In the same circle, all radii are equal and all diameters are equal.

7. The same circle has countless radii and countless diameters.

8. The diameter of the same circle is twice the radius, and the radius is half the diameter.

9. Circumference: The length of the curve around a circle is called circumference.

10. The circumference of a circle is always greater than 3 times the diameter, and this ratio is a fixed number. 12. Area of the circle: The area occupied by the circle is called the area of the circle.

15. Draw the largest circle in a square, and the diameter of the circle is equal to the side length of the square.

16. Draw the largest circle in the rectangle, and the diameter of the circle is equal to the width of the rectangle.
